L'Heureux got 2 suspensions (3 games total) in his rookie season.

1 game for getting an instigator penalty in the final five minutes of a game. An automatic suspension and he didnt do anything noteworthy here

2 games for giving Dach a gloved punch after Dach took a questionable hit/run on L'Heureux. Suspension was warrented.


The penalty minutes were really high due to the officials whipping out 10 minute misconducts because he was verbally mean to them. His minor penalty discipline was actually pretty good. He will have to learn to bite his tongue.

He was suspended 9 times in the Q so this is progress

Alot was "abuse of officials" and considering none of them were from him laying hands on them, i read into it as "he said mean things to me because i didnt what he wanted". That can be making a bad call or ignoring something that shouldve been called. They let players take runs at him without making calls which would piss me off took if i were him.
His 10 minute penalties:

1 abuse was at the very end of the game after time expired so who cares

1 abuse was given after he also was given a penalty for diving/embellishment near end of 2nd period

2 abuse concurrent ones were given after being given a penalty for diving/embellishment near end of 2nd period

3 different game misconducts - instigator, punching Dach after a bad hit, and a bad cross check - last 2 mentioned here are earned, 1st one is automatic.

An unsportsmanlike in the last 3 minutes of a game.

1 abuse after being given a crosschecking penalty with under 2 minutes left (might as well since he wasnt coming back that game anyways)
1 misconduct with 11 seconds left in the game

So seems like the abuse calls are mostly after questionable calls like diving or at the end of the game when passions are high and team impact is lower and it can be used as a rallying cry.

Worst ones were from a bad crosscheck and retaliation against Dach which led to a suspension as well.
